Transaction 731688529666f10b85c83498516615ba1e737e3694b4dbc8acbd7e1a54c131be

1 Input
2 Outputs
  • 731688529666f10b85c83498516615ba1e737e3694b4dbc8acbd7e1a54c131be:0
  • value  1124854
    address  3QbGxAeEMg6PGnYG8QPVb2PeWUN8pZFJ7K
  • 731688529666f10b85c83498516615ba1e737e3694b4dbc8acbd7e1a54c131be:1
  • value  64014896
    address  3JW3rPYSucrriRzLogPkRBVYfQ7G6nwEYo